The aim of this study was to investigate the relationship between family functioning and mental health staff at of Medical sciences.
Materials and Methods: This study was a descriptive study and the population included all the employees working at the Kurdistan University of Medical sciences who were 384 people and 185 of them were chosen using Cochran formula. Demographic questionnaire, McMaster family Questionnaire (1983), Goldverg mental Health (1972) and the data were analyzed using descriptive and inferential statistics.

Conclusion: The findings of this study showed that the family is the most effective environmental factor in the development of individuals and the mental health of every individual is positively or negatively affected by the performance of their families. As a result one of the crucial factors of mental health is family performance.
